Output 58c097e021e6357d8f8301ce775c2cc51d5ab14b7c9002b7e83e11fd78d525ed:0

value
3857009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ca256051cf2baf6e2ef4268a1624e3bf67ab58d4 OP_EQUAL
address
3L7sCEvAa8m85uFxVwhisjUR6MuNzqLLTT
transaction
58c097e021e6357d8f8301ce775c2cc51d5ab14b7c9002b7e83e11fd78d525ed
confirmations
111962
spent
true